Analyzing Experiences of White Mothers of Daughters and Sons of Color

Across the U. S., Chandler provides an insider's view of the complex ways in which Whiteness norms appear and operate.

Through uncovering and analyzing Whiteness norms occurring across motherhood stages, Chandler has developed a model of three common ways of interacting with the norms of Whiteness: colluding, colliding, and contending.

Chandler's results suggest that collisions with Whiteness norms are a necessary step to increasing one's racial literacy, which is essential for effective contentions with norms of Whiteness.

She proposes steps for applying her model in education settings, which can also be applied in other organizational contexts.
